Overview

5-methyl-2-nitroaniline (CAS 578-46-1) is an aromatic nitroaniline compound with methyl substitution exhibiting significant toxicological properties. This organic chemical compound, with molecular formula C7H8N2O2 and molecular weight 152.15 g/mol, belongs to the nitroaniline family of aromatic amines. The substance features both nitro and amino functional groups attached to a methylated benzene ring, creating a versatile intermediate for various chemical syntheses. Its structural configuration positions the methyl group at the 5-position and the nitro group at the 2-position relative to the amino group, distinguishing it from other nitroaniline isomers. 5-methyl-2-nitroaniline presents serious safety considerations, classified under multiple acute toxicity categories and requiring careful handling protocols. The compound carries GHS pictograms for toxicity (GHS06), health hazards (GHS08), and environmental hazards (GHS09), with a "Danger" signal word. Its classification as ADR class 6.1 indicates toxic substance properties requiring specialized transportation procedures. The substance also poses risks for specific target organ toxicity following repeated exposure and chronic aquatic toxicity. Primary industrial applications include its use as an intermediate in pharmaceutical synthesis, dye manufacturing, and agrochemical production. The compound serves as a building block for creating more complex molecular structures, particularly in the development of specialized colorants and medicinal compounds. Safety & Classification

Danger
Classification:

Acute Tox. 3 *; Acute Tox. 3 *; Acute Tox. 3 *; STOT RE 2 *; Aquatic Chronic 2

HHazard Statements (H-Statements)

Describe the nature and severity of the hazard

H331

Toxic if inhaled.

H311

Toxic in contact with skin.

H301

Toxic if swallowed.

H373

May cause damage to organs through prolonged or repeated exposure.

H411

Toxic to aquatic life with long lasting effects.

Classification according to CLP Regulation (EC) No 1272/2008. The complete list of hazard and precautionary statements can be found in the Safety Data Sheet (SDS).

How to handle 5-methyl-2-nitroaniline safely?

5-methyl-2-nitroaniline requires strict safety measures due to its Acute Tox. 3 classification and STOT RE 2 hazard class. Personnel must wear appropriate PPE including chemical-resistant gloves, safety goggles, and respiratory protection. Work should be conducted in well-ventilated areas or under fume hoods. Avoid skin contact, inhalation, and ingestion, as the compound poses serious health risks through multiple exposure routes.

How to store 5-methyl-2-nitroaniline correctly?

5-methyl-2-nitroaniline must be stored in a cool, dry, well-ventilated area away from heat sources, direct sunlight, and incompatible materials. Keep containers tightly sealed and properly labeled according to GHS requirements. Store separately from strong oxidizers, acids, and bases. Ensure storage areas have appropriate spill containment measures and are accessible only to trained personnel due to the compound's hazardous nature.

What to do in case of contact with 5-methyl-2-nitroaniline?

Immediate action is required in case of contact with 5-methyl-2-nitroaniline due to its acute toxicity. For skin contact, remove contaminated clothing and rinse thoroughly with water for at least 15 minutes. If inhaled, move to fresh air immediately. In case of eye contact, flush with clean water for 15 minutes. Seek medical attention promptly for any exposure, and provide the safety data sheet to medical personnel.

How to dispose of 5-methyl-2-nitroaniline appropriately?

5-methyl-2-nitroaniline must be disposed of as hazardous waste through licensed waste management companies in accordance with local and European regulations. Never dispose of this compound in regular waste streams or pour down drains due to its environmental hazard classification (Aquatic Chronic 2). Collect waste in appropriate containers, label clearly, and ensure proper documentation for the disposal chain as required by waste regulations.

How to transport 5-methyl-2-nitroaniline?

5-methyl-2-nitroaniline is classified as ADR Class 6.1 (toxic substances), Packing Group III for transportation purposes. Packages must bear appropriate hazard labels and comply with ADR packaging requirements for toxic substances. Transport vehicles need proper placarding and documentation. Only authorized carriers with appropriate training and equipment should handle the transportation of this hazardous chemical compound across European borders.
